Activation of modules is the second mandatory step. What modules you will activate depends on what you want to do with Dolibarr. In most cases, you may want to use all modules. You have to enable one by one each module you plan to use. For example, to manage a company, you might activate modules: Third party, Invoices and Products, but probably a lot of more modules.
